| | | Family | Dipsacaceae | | Plant Type | herbaceous perennial | | Zone | USDA: 3a - 7b RHS: H EGF: H1 - H3 Australia: 1 | | Care Level | low, easy, suitable for beginners. | | Height | 30 - 45 cm (12 - 18 in) | | Spread | 30 - 45 cm (12 - 18 in) | | Light | full sun | | Soil Moisture | average, well-drained | | Soil Type | clay to sandy | | Soil pH | acidic to alkaline | | | Description | Scabiosa caucasica 'Vivid Violet' (dwarf pincushion flower) bears showy and faded purple blooms during early summer to early autumn. | | Typical Uses | Accent, alpine or rock garden, border, container, cut flowers, edging and mass planting. | | Special Characteristics | Butterflies are attracted to Scabiosa caucasica 'Vivid Violet' . Scabiosa caucasica 'Vivid Violet' is tolerant of drought. | | |
